Pithampur Poly Products Ltd. engages in the manufactures and trading of HDPE/PP woven sacks and allied products. It sells PP woven fabric, woven sacks, and FIBCs. The company was founded on July 28, 1994 and is headquartered in Indore, India.

PITHP reached its all-time high on Dec 5, 2011 with the price of 28.00 INR, and its all-time low was 1.25 INR and was reached on Mar 26, 2004. View more price dynamics on PITHP chart.
